11.00 - 12.00 Travel Technology - Negotiating the Minefield
Tom Stone, Director of Travel Management - Universal Music UK

Self service reservations or on-line booking systems are the way of the future. The problem is that not everyone is ready for them now. How should a travel purchaser determine whether their organisation is ready? How do they decide which system to use? And what is the strategic return on investment? This presentation empathises with the dilemma many travel managers face in considering the application of technology to their travel programs and looks at a case study to assist in selecting the best route forwards. It also considers how travel agents can turn on-line booking access to their advantage.
